The Timeless Appeal of Victorian Staircases
Victorian staircases, with their intricate balustrades, ornate newel posts, and sweeping treads, epitomize the grandeur of 19th-century design. Renovating these features preserves original character while adapting to contemporary living—balancing historical authenticity with modern safety and comfort standards.
Key Elements of a Professional Victorian Staircase Renovation
A successful renovation focuses on structural integrity, authentic materials, and meticulous detail. This includes restoring original wood with careful refinishing, replacing damaged treads, restoring carving, and updating handrails using period-appropriate techniques. Modern safety upgrades like non-slip finishes and secure handrails are seamlessly integrated without compromising aesthetic integrity.
Benefits of Restoring Rather Than Replacing
Restoring a Victorian staircase honors architectural heritage and offers greater long-term value than replacement. It maintains the home’s unique identity, retains proven craftsmanship, and often proves more cost-effective. Professionals ensure finishes, materials, and structural supports meet current building codes while retaining original charm.
